Retirement of the Xbox 360 Store

The Xbox 360 store will be shutting down on July 29, 2024, which means you will no longer be able to purchase new games or DLC (downloadable content) on the console. However, you will still be able to play and download games you already own on Xbox 360, as well as games that are compatible with the Xbox One and Xbox Series X|S consoles through backward compatibility.

Backward Compatibility

Xbox 360 games that are backward compatible with Xbox One and Xbox Series X|S consoles can still be downloaded and played on these consoles. This means you can continue to play your Xbox 360 games on your newer console without any issues.

How to Download Xbox 360 Games on Xbox One and Xbox Series X|S

To download Xbox 360 games on Xbox One and Xbox Series X|S, you can follow these steps:

  • Go to the Xbox Store on your Xbox One or Xbox Series X|S console
  • Search for the Xbox 360 game you want to download
  • Select the game and click "Install" to download and install it on your console
